| import { z } from "zod" | |
| import { fn } from "./util/fn" | |
| import { Actor } from "./actor" | |
| import { and, Database, eq, isNull, sql } from "./drizzle" | |
| import { Identifier } from "./identifier" | |
| import { KeyTable } from "./schema/key.sql" | |
| import { UserTable } from "./schema/user.sql" | |
| import { AuthTable } from "./schema/auth.sql" | |
| export namespace Key { | |
| export const list = fn(z.void(), async () => { | |
| const keys = await Database.use((tx) => | |
| tx | |
| .select({ | |
| id: KeyTable.id, | |
| name: KeyTable.name, | |
| key: KeyTable.key, | |
| timeUsed: KeyTable.timeUsed, | |
| userID: KeyTable.userID, | |
| email: AuthTable.subject, | |
| }) | |
| .from(KeyTable) | |
| .innerJoin(UserTable, and(eq(KeyTable.userID, UserTable.id), eq(KeyTable.workspaceID, UserTable.workspaceID))) | |
| .innerJoin(AuthTable, and(eq(UserTable.accountID, AuthTable.accountID), eq(AuthTable.provider, "email"))) | |
| .where( | |
| and( | |
| eq(KeyTable.workspaceID, Actor.workspace()), | |
| isNull(KeyTable.timeDeleted), | |
| ...(Actor.userRole() === "admin" ? [] : [eq(KeyTable.userID, Actor.userID())]), | |
| ), | |
| ) | |
| .orderBy(sql`${KeyTable.name} DESC`), | |
| ) | |
| // only return value for user's keys | |
| return keys.map((key) => ({ | |
| ...key, | |
| key: key.userID === Actor.userID() ? key.key : undefined, | |
| keyDisplay: `${key.key.slice(0, 7)}...${key.key.slice(-4)}`, | |
| })) | |
| }) | |
| export const create = fn( | |
| z.object({ | |
| userID: z.string(), | |
| name: z.string().min(1).max(255), | |
| }), | |
| async (input) => { | |
| const { name } = input | |
| // Generate secret key: sk- + 64 random characters (upper, lower, numbers) | |
| const chars = "ABCDEFGHIJKLMNOPQRSTUVWXYZabcdefghijklmnopqrstuvwxyz0123456789" | |
| let secretKey = "sk-" | |
| const array = new Uint32Array(64) | |
| crypto.getRandomValues(array) | |
| for (let i = 0, l = array.length; i < l; i++) { | |
| secretKey += chars[array[i] % chars.length] | |
| } | |
| const keyID = Identifier.create("key") | |
| await Database.use((tx) => | |
| tx.insert(KeyTable).values({ | |
| id: keyID, | |
| workspaceID: Actor.workspace(), | |
| userID: input.userID, | |
| name, | |
| key: secretKey, | |
| timeUsed: null, | |
| }), | |
| ) | |
| return keyID | |
| }, | |
| ) | |
| export const remove = fn(z.object({ id: z.string() }), async (input) => { | |
| // only admin can remove other user's keys | |
| await Database.use((tx) => | |
| tx | |
| .update(KeyTable) | |
| .set({ | |
| timeDeleted: sql`now()`, | |
| }) | |
| .where( | |
| and( | |
| eq(KeyTable.id, input.id), | |
| eq(KeyTable.workspaceID, Actor.workspace()), | |
| ...(Actor.userRole() === "admin" ? [] : [eq(KeyTable.userID, Actor.userID())]), | |
| ), | |
| ), | |
| ) | |
| }) | |
| } | |
